Avessi tempo e passione imparerei pure un po' di SVG. Il fatto è che mi ci sono imbattuto (al 99% sarà l'unico punto dell'intero progetto dove dovrò utilizzarlo) e volevo sbrigarmela senza troppe complicazioni!

Riferito al codice sopra:
Codice PHP:
<svg xmlns='http://www.w3.org/2000/svg' width='200' height='200'>
    <
foreignObject width='100%' height='100%'>
        <
style
           @
font-face  {     font-family'Neuropol'
           
srcurl('http://127.0.0.1:8888/gui/font.ttf'format('truetype');  }
          .
wfont-family'Neuropol'color:white;}
        </
style>
        <
div xmlns='http://www.w3.org/1999/xhtml' class='w' style='font-size:40px;'>
             <
span class='w' style='text-shadow:1px 1px 8px red;'>I like cheese</span>
             [
img]http://127.0.0.1:8888/gui/ico.fw.png[/img]
        
</div>
    </
foreignObject>
</
svg
Ho inserito il font-face ma il testo non viene visualizzato (è come se non riconoscesse il font). Se al posto di Neuropol provo un comune Arial funziona senza problemi -_- All'inizio pensavo fosse un problema di url e che l'svg non riuscisse a caricare il font ma come vedete ho provato ad inserire anche un'immagine e questa viene caricata e visualizzata correttamente.

Sinceramente non so come muovermi <.<